Last year I got some little Bantam Cochins in a feed store bin. By Fall I had the next generation. I lost my little rooster the second day we had triple digit temps. That was about a month ago. I cranked up the incubator for the few eggs I had . Here are the 6 chicks that resulted from those eggs.Smile

Yes, they are fuzzy legged and footed. I never had a feather legged chicken until a couple of years ago. Now I have several breeds of fuzzy feets. I have two different breeds with 5 toes. When they all run loose, I sure find funny tracks all around here.
I generally use big aquariums to brood chicks for the first week or so. I set them so the grandkids can watch the babies. I will have to wade through the puppies to get to an aquarium, but I will try to get one out and set it up. I get much better pictures in the aquariums. Smile
